Two of Iowa’s ski areas are officially open for the 2024/25 ski and snowboard season, with both Seven Oaks Recreation in Boone County and Sundown Mountain Resort in Dubuque County opening this past Saturday, November 30.

Sundown started on Saturday with 4 open runs, Turkey, Sun Express, Buckaroo, & Sunshine, in addition to several terrain park features on Sunshine. Lifts were spinning from 11am to 4pm through opening weekend, and by Sunday, December 1, three more trails were able to open. Sundown is closed again Monday-Thursday of this week, but should be going again with regular season hours beginning on Friday, December 6.

Meanwhile at Seven Oaks Recreation, Saturday kicked off with early season skiing and snowboarding from 11am to 5pm. School Yard, Carters Crossing, and Abby’s Alley were open to kick off the season, accessed by Valley View Triple Chair, and Slow Poke. Additionally several park features, including a 20′ round rail, a. small kicker, a 10′ round rail, and a 12′ pyramid, were open for the park fans.

Seven Oaks Recreation is also closed between Monday and Thursday of this week, though things should get going once again with evening skiing from 4pm to 9pm on Friday, December 6. Cheers to the snowmakers for making the ski season happen!
